Elina Danielian scores first win at  Fide Women’s Grand Prix

PanARMENIAN.Net - Armenian grandmaster Elina Danielian beat Humpy Koneru (India) at the third round of Fide Women’s Grand Prix.

Meanwhile, Lilit Mkrtchian lost to Ruan Lufei (China). Zhao Xue (China) and Ekaterina Kovalevskaya (Russia) scored wins against Nino Khurtsidze (Georgia) and Munguntuul Batkhuyag (Mongolia) respectively.

Hou Yifan (China)- Ju Wenjun (China) and Nadezhda Kosintseva (Russia)- Kateryna Lahno (Ukraine) games ended in a draw.
